Intel® Turbo Boost Technology in Windows Server 2008? i need a driver? (i have a i7)

Turbo Boost is automatic if enabled by the BIOS and the OS.

You BIOS settings for C states need to be enabled

and the 2008 power preformance settings need to be set to balanced, not preformance. (preformance will lock the CPU's at the rated max speed and prevent the unit from going into turbo boost mode.

Some software that monitors turbo boost may require a driver, but turbo boost does not.
